In computer programming, foreach loop (or for-each loop) is a control flow statement for traversing items in a collection. foreach is usually used in place of a standard for loop statement.
Spring Batch is an open source framework for batch processing. It is a lightweight, comprehensive solution designed to enable the development of robust batch applications, [1] which are often found in modern enterprise systems. Spring Batch builds upon the POJO-based development approach of the Spring Framework. [2]
The IBM OS/2 operating system supported DOS-style batch files. It also included a version of REXX, a more advanced batch-file scripting language. By default, Spring boot provides embedded web servers (such as Tomcat) out-of-the-box. [21] However, Spring Boot can also be deployed as a WAR file on a standalone WildFly application server. [22] If Maven is used as the build tool, there is a wildfly-maven-plugin Maven plugin that allows for automatic deployment of the generated WAR file. [22]

The event loop almost always operates asynchronously with the message originator. When the event loop forms the central control flow construct of a program, as it often does, it may be termed the main loop or main event loop. This title is appropriate, because such an event loop is at the highest level of control within the program.
Loop unrolling, also known as loop unwinding, is a loop transformation technique that attempts to optimize a program's execution speed at the expense of its binary size, which is an approach known as space–time tradeoff. The transformation can be undertaken manually by the programmer or by an optimizing compiler.
